Compare Milwaukee to Tucson


Milwaukee has a similar population count than Tucson: 596974 compared with 486699.

Looking at housing units, the perc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 54.7% for Milwaukee versus 46.6% for Tucson.

The percentage of households with kids is quite similar between the two cities: 30.5% for Milwaukee and 29.0% for Tucson.

The median age for people living in Milwaukee is 30.6 years old, while it is 32.1 years for Tucson.


The average daily temperature (Fahrenheit) on the first of each month (from January 1st at left, to December 1st at right) is:

Milwaukee,26,28,30,42,50,61,70,75,69,59,47,32,
Tucson,52,52,55,63,73,83,90,85,85,78,64,54,
